Set in Kasese, 25km from Katunguru, Kasenyi Lake Retreat & Campsite offers accommodation. The lodge is set on the shores of Lake George inside Queen Elizabeth National Park.

We love this place. It's basic accommodation but in an amazing location. You eat breakfast and dinner with hippos aside. Welcoming and kind owner who showed us hippos during the evening. Fresh fish from the lake for dinner. Our best experience with accommodation in Uganda. Thanks

Ideal for nature-lovers looking for a self-sufficient getaway, lodges are fully furnished and self-catered. Usually made of wood and surrounded by forests or mountains, lodges can be part of a group or a single unit. More remote than holiday homes, lodges are popular for safari trips.
